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in meteorology, atmospheric science, or a related field
  • 3+ years of experience in broadcast and multimedia news content generation
  • Ability to write for broadcast news and digital platforms
  • Ability to visualize and create weather graphics
  • Understanding of principal journalistic ethics
  • Valid driver's license and good driving record
  • Willingness and ability to work in extreme weather conditions while reporting on breaking weather events

Responsibilities

  • Analyze weather data and prepare detailed and engaging weather forecasts
  • Generate creative and engaging, content-driven live shots
  • Familiarity with the WSI weather system and software is a plus
  • Ability to drive long-form severe weather/event coverage solo or in a team setting, both in the studio and in the field
  • Ability to multitask, handle breaking weather/events, and adapt to rapidly changing developments
  • Cover other meteorologists' shifts, as assigned, as well as the flexibility to cover shifts during severe weather/events
  • Post daily stories to our digital platforms and social media, including online weather discussions to explain complex weather phenomena in an easy-to-understand format
  • Be actively involved on the station's social media platforms and responsive to viewer inquiries
  • Represent Alaska's News Source at community and station-sponsored events, including school presentations and station tours
  • Record shortened daily weathercasts for radio partners
  • Work closely with the Chief Meteorologist, news management, photographers, and newscast producers to deliver exceptional weather coverage and regular reporting
